Episode 37: Healthy Boundaries… How To Say No Authentically

by Elaine Froese | February 4, 2025 | Farm Family Harmony Podcast

In this episode, I sit down with Farm Family Coach Kalynn Spain – a certified Leadership Coach with a degree in Conflict Resolution Studies and over five years of training and volunteer experience as a mediator. In this discussion Kalynn shares recent insights from her experience with moving in with the in-laws and beginning the challenging, but hopeful journey of farm succession planning.

We also explore how healthy boundaries are essential to stay firm as a family when transitioning to farm life. We discuss what it looks like to remain true to your own family values, dreams, and schedules while integrating with life on the farm.

By the end of the episode, you’ll have gained a new perspective on the importance of boundaries for self-care, a sense of safety, living authentically, and working together towards a more intentional future.

“It’s really about centering ourselves and using our own control and our own sense of authority. And I think this can apply in adult relationships as well. Because it’s really hard to center ourselves sometimes when we feel uncomfortable, or maybe someone’s making a request of us where we feel like the farm is asking us for our time, and like the farm comes first. There are all sorts of expectations. It’s the culture of the farm and it can be really hard to say no.” – Kalynn Spain
